PAPA

There are worse things
you could do on a Saturday.

Silly fathers sit in
death's double-wide;
sniffing his laudanum-
laced carpet.

Simple fathers tell
clean lies to
irrelevant wives with
happy pill habits.

Senseless fathers
drink, drag, drug
their way to pretty
nothingness.

Our fort’s lid,
comprised of a
yellow comforter,
dips above our heads,
tickles my ear as
you shuffle the deck.

We sit on the kitchen floor;
legs crossed, deep air
sticking to our lungs,
like honey on toast.

There are worse things
you could do on a Saturday.

WHERE THE TILE MET THE WOOD

I was out of place.
There were paisley chintz chairs
and white-teethed wedding albums
and no dusty books.

I stared where the living room
met the foyer
and where the tile
met the wood.

The woman who sat across
was all pointy elbows
and bitter lips.

That woman spat out words,
words that sounded like 
tasting bleach.
Things like, "You are no 
daughter of the Lord and
you are no daughter of mine."

Silence slunk from
the air between us,
cowed,
whimpering in my bones.

And I sat on the 
clinically white sofa and
stared where the tile
met the wood and
hummed to myself
just to make her
mourn.
